Package app.knock.api.model
Class WorkflowTriggerRequest.WorkflowTriggerRequestBuilder
- java.lang.Object
-
- app.knock.api.model.WorkflowTriggerRequest.WorkflowTriggerRequestBuilder
-
- Enclosing class:
- WorkflowTriggerRequest
public static class WorkflowTriggerRequest.WorkflowTriggerRequestBuilder extends java.lang.Object
-
-
Method Summary
-
-
-
Method Detail
-
addActor
public WorkflowTriggerRequest.WorkflowTriggerRequestBuilder addActor(WorkflowTriggerRequest.ObjectRecipientIdentifier identifier)
-
addActor
public WorkflowTriggerRequest.WorkflowTriggerRequestBuilder addActor(java.lang.String actor)
-
addRecipient
public WorkflowTriggerRequest.WorkflowTriggerRequestBuilder addRecipient(java.lang.String... userIds)
-
addRecipient
public WorkflowTriggerRequest.WorkflowTriggerRequestBuilder addRecipient(java.util.Map<java.lang.String,java.lang.Object> recipient)
-
addRecipient
public WorkflowTriggerRequest.WorkflowTriggerRequestBuilder addRecipient(WorkflowTriggerRequest.ObjectRecipientIdentifier identifier)
-
typeName
public WorkflowTriggerRequest.WorkflowTriggerRequestBuilder typeName(java.lang.String typeName)
- Returns:
this.
-
key
public WorkflowTriggerRequest.WorkflowTriggerRequestBuilder key(java.lang.String key)
- Returns:
this.
-
actor
public WorkflowTriggerRequest.WorkflowTriggerRequestBuilder actor(java.lang.Object actor)
- Returns:
this.
-
recipients
public WorkflowTriggerRequest.WorkflowTriggerRequestBuilder recipients(java.util.List<java.lang.Object> recipients)
- Returns:
this.
-
cancellationKey
public WorkflowTriggerRequest.WorkflowTriggerRequestBuilder cancellationKey(java.lang.String cancellationKey)
- Returns:
this.
-
tenant
public WorkflowTriggerRequest.WorkflowTriggerRequestBuilder tenant(java.lang.String tenant)
- Returns:
this.
-
data
public WorkflowTriggerRequest.WorkflowTriggerRequestBuilder data(java.lang.String dataKey, java.lang.Object dataValue)
-
data
public WorkflowTriggerRequest.WorkflowTriggerRequestBuilder data(java.util.Map<? extends java.lang.String,? extends java.lang.Object> data)
-
clearData
public WorkflowTriggerRequest.WorkflowTriggerRequestBuilder clearData()
-
build
public WorkflowTriggerRequest build()
-
toString
public java.lang.String toString()
- Overrides:
toStringin classjava.lang.Object
-
-